    One thing to consider is that both inverter control panels may not be wired to start the generator. Unless the generator has multiple wiring harness/control board connections, allowing multiple generator start signals, only one of the inverter control panels will be physically connected.

    This certainly is how Magnum AGS works. I have no information if the older Trace controllers are similar.

    If you do not know which inverter control panel is used to trigger a AGS, the safe thing is to set both to Auto. That way, whichever one is connected will be able to send the AGS signal.

    Here’s how my 24v Marathon with Trace 4000’s is setup. Disclaimer, this is what works for me, so don’t yell at me because your’s is setup different or someone has told you to use different settings.

    There are various settings for each menu, you can use the defaults for most other settings. Once you learn the Trace setups, it’s all easy and makes sense. Well, most of the time anyways.

    Setup 9 – Inverter Setup

    LBCO 24

    LBCI 26

    Setup 10 – Charging

    Bulk 28.6

    Absorbtion – 3 hours

    Float 26.8

    Max Charge 15

    Setup 12 – Autogen

    Set Load 53

    Load start 5

    Load stop 5

    24 hour start 24.6

    2 hour start 23.6

    15 min start 22.6

    Read LBCO 24

    Max Run Time 30 hrs.

    Other Notes

    I use my number one inverter for autostart and charging. My number 2 inverter is basiclly a monitor, I set the Absorption Charge to 000 which in turn leaves in on Float and no bulk charge. The autostart for the number 2 inverter is also off. You can have conflicts beween the 2 inverters when both are set to control charging and autostart.

    If I’m running pole to pole with no dry camping or just unplugging the bus to move it outside to wash, I disable the number 1 inverter Bulk/Absorbtion charge by setting it to 000 and it then stays in float when I plug back in. No point in running a complete Bulk/Absorption cycle when the batteries are full. Same while driving from pole to pole, the batteries are full charged by the alternator when arriving at destination, so again, why cycle through a complete Bulk/Absorbtion when not needed. AGM battery life is all about cycles.

    See the above Tim, LBCO and LBCI.

    LBCO – Low Battery Cut Out – When the inverter see’s this volage for 15 minutes, it shuts down. This won’t happen if the Auto-Start is active because the gen will start and the inverter won’t shut down.

    LBCI – Low Battery Cut In – When the inverter see’s this voltage, it turns back on. If you’re using Auto-Start, you’ll never see this because the inverter has not shut down.

    Look at it this way… If your bus is stored, no shore, no generator and no auto-start, when the inverter see’s the LBCO for 15 minutes, if shuts off. It won’t turn back on until is see’s the LBCI that would have to come from the inverter chargers (shore or gen) or the engine alternator.

    If your generator starts at around 24.3 which I am guessing is less than resting voltage because there will be some load on them you are at a safe point. Tom can verify this, but in general you are lightly discharged and will have an extended life as a result.

    But just because batteries are two years old it does not mean you can’t have a problem. I am not saying you do, but a defect such as a bad cell can cause a premature failure, as can abuse such as deep discharges. To be sure of your true battery condition you have to disconnect the cables so they are isolated from one another and all loads and test them individually after they have been fully charged and the inverters go to float.

    Our batteries have proven extremely reliable and if properly maintained I think it is safe to say you will see at least 5 years of good performance from them, and if you are willing to push their life a little you can probably go as long as 8 to 10 years but you will see a substantial loss of the ability to hold a charge as they age. If you see evidence of bulging do not hesitate to replace them and if you get the smell of rotten eggs they are ruined because the pressure relief valve has opened.

    Those settings won’t come into play while the auto-start is set to read your LBCO of 24v. If your’s started at 24.3, that seems reasonable, I can’t explain the technical stuff.

    If your gen started within 20 minutes, that would lead me to believe you have bad batteries, assuming you had 2 A/C’s or heat pumps running. If your living in the bus dry camping with just normal loads, fridge, lights, tv and no big amp hogs running, you should easily go 12+ hours before reaching 24v.
